Title:
POWER-SOURCE-LESS TRANSPARENT COOLING DEVICE
Document Type and Number:
WIPO Patent Application WO/2021/166781
Kind Code:
A1
Abstract:
A power-source-less transparent cooling device comprising an infrared reflecting layer, a first heat radiating layer, and a second heat radiating layer in this order, wherein: the power-source-less transparent cooling device has average visible light transmittance of 80% or greater and haze of 10% or lower; the first heat radiating layer contains a material different from that of the second heat radiating layer and has an absorption peak of 50% or greater in the wavelength region of 8-13 μm; the second heat radiating layer has an absorption peak of 50% or greater in the wavelength region of 7-10 μm; and the infrared reflecting layer has an average reflectance of 80% or greater in the wavelength range of 7-13 μm.
